Arlington, VA – The National Alliance on Mental Illness (NAMI) and Hall of Fame NFL Quarterback Dan Marino have announced a dynamic collaboration to advance mental health awareness, prevention, and access to resources for student-athletes, HBCU campuses, and faith leaders. The campaign will debut during the week leading up to the big game in New Orleans, leveraging high-profile NFL-sanctioned platforms including Athletes in Action’s Super Bowl Breakfast, Taste of the NFL, and Radio Row appearances.
This initiative comes at a pivotal moment as mental health concerns rise, particularly among young adults and athletes. A recent NCAA Student-Athlete Well-Being Study found that mental health concerns were highest among demographic subgroups commonly displaying higher rates of mental distress, including student-athletes of color.

Through the Stay Healthy Zone, Dan Marino continues his long-standing commitment to philanthropy and mental health awareness, aligning with NAMI’s mission to support well-being. Stay Healthy Zone is a digital wellness platform offering personalized meal plans, fitness videos, and wellness challenges led by celebrity ambassadors to help individuals manage stress, improve health, and build resilience.
This collaboration will provide tools, campus programs, and faith-based outreach to promote mental well-being nationwide.
